What is a Buy And Sell Agreement?
A Buy and Sell Agreement is a fundamental commercial document used in Singapore to formalize the transfer of goods, assets, or property between parties. This agreement is particularly important as it provides a clear framework for transactions while ensuring compliance with Singapore's legal requirements, including the Sale of Goods Act and relevant commercial laws. The document typically includes detailed specifications of the items being sold, price and payment terms, delivery arrangements, warranties, and remedies for breach. It's essential for both routine commercial transactions and more complex asset transfers, providing legal certainty and protection for all parties involved.

When do you need this document?
You need a Buy and Sell Agreement whenever you're transferring ownership of goods or assets in Singapore. This includes selling business equipment, vehicles, inventory, intellectual property, or any valuable items where clear legal documentation is essential. The document becomes particularly important for high-value transactions, business-to-business sales, or when dealing with parties you don't know well. If you're a business owner selling products to consumers, this agreement ensures compliance with the Consumer Protection (Fair Trading) Act and establishes your rights under Singapore law.
Key legal considerations
Your Buy and Sell Agreement must clearly identify all parties, including any guarantors or agents involved in the transaction. The subject matter section requires detailed descriptions of what you're selling, including specifications, conditions, and any included accessories or components. Payment terms should specify the purchase price, payment method, and timing, while delivery terms must outline when, where, and how transfer occurs. Warranties are crucial - you need to specify what guarantees you're providing about the goods' condition, authenticity, and performance. Include dispute resolution mechanisms and specify remedies for breach, such as damages or specific performance. Consider including clauses for inspection periods, return policies, and liability limitations where appropriate.
Legal requirements in Singapore
Under Singapore law, your Buy and Sell Agreement must comply with the Sale of Goods Act, which governs the transfer of title and implied terms regarding quality and fitness for purpose. The Electronic Transactions Act allows for digital signatures and electronic agreements, provided proper authentication methods are used. If you're a business, ensure compliance with GST requirements under the Goods and Services Tax Act, including proper tax calculations and reporting obligations. Consumer sales must adhere to the Consumer Protection (Fair Trading) Act, which prohibits unfair practices and provides specific consumer remedies. Corporate sellers must ensure they have proper authority under the Companies Act to enter into the agreement. The contract should specify Singapore law as the governing jurisdiction and include proper execution clauses that meet local legal standards for enforceability.
